Basketball teams looking to rebound after slow start

The boy’s J.V. and varsity basketball teams both lost their first three games of the season. They rebounded with big wins against Tarpon, but disappointed in their last game vs. Clearwater. Although the teams are struggling, they have had a hard schedule so far and it will lighten up the rest of the way.

The teams’ first two losses to Gibbs and Largo were close ones. The J.V. team only lost by a total of 3 combined points. In fact, the J.V. team was leading Largo in the first quarter by the score of 24-9. Largo then had a full court press, which is a defensive formation of 1-2-1-1, and it was hard to score for the rest of the game.

Sam Purdy, on of two seniors on the varsity team, had scored 21 points in the Largo game. He was also 4 for 4 from the three point line in the first quarter. Along with there only being two seniors, there are two sophomore starters Kevin McKellar and Chaz Green. Ja-Tyuan Landing, who is a very good defender on the J.V. team, had an impressive 13 steals in the first two games.

Some key factors in the team’s success are good guard play and a lot of help off the bench. The backups are doing well for both squads. One thing that the J.V. team particularly has to work on is playing under pressure and something the varsity team should improve on is creating good, quality shots on offense. Neither of these teams expected to start out like this, especially losing three straight games, but they have the players to bounce back from this.
